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Jannus Live is located in the bustling center of downtown St. Petersburg, anchored by the iconic 200 1st Avenue North address. The venue sits within a highly walkable district known for its eclectic mix of murals, bars, and diverse culinary offerings. Visitors typically arrive via I-275, taking the I-375 or I-175 exits to reach the city core. While the venue does not have its own dedicated parking lot, numerous public parking garages and street spaces are available within a short walking distance. The nearest major airport is Tampa International Airport (TPA), which is approximately a 25 to 30-minute drive away under normal traffic conditions.

Navigating the downtown area is straightforward due to the grid layout, though event nights can increase congestion significantly. Rideshare services like Uber and Lyft are highly recommended for visitors who prefer not to hunt for limited street parking. If you are staying at a nearby hotel, you can often reach the venue on foot within minutes. For those driving in from further away, checking the status of local street closures is a smart move before departure. Arriving at least 45 minutes before doors open will help you secure a convenient parking spot and avoid the peak entry rush.

Section 05

Things to Do

Walkable

The Dali Museum

0.4 mi

This world-renowned museum houses an extensive collection of Salvador Dali's surrealist masterpieces in a stunning architectural space. It is a must-see for art lovers visiting the city and offers a quiet, contemplative atmosphere. The exhibits are beautifully curated, providing deep insight into the artist's life and unique creative process. Spend an afternoon wandering through the gallery spaces before heading out to dinner.

St. Pete Pier

0.5 mi

The St. Pete Pier is a massive waterfront destination that features parks, fishing areas, and several dining options overlooking the bay. It is perfect for a leisurely stroll before the concert to enjoy the coastal breeze and beautiful views. You can explore the various interactive art installations or simply relax on the benches while watching boats pass by. It offers a great way to experience the local lifestyle while remaining close to the downtown venue.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ters are mild and comfortable with temperatures typically in the 60s and 70s. You will likely only need a light jacket for the evening hours. It is an ideal time to enjoy the outdoor venue without worrying about extreme heat or humidity during the show.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Expect warming temperatures and plenty of sunshine as the city transitions into summer. Light clothing is perfect, though you might want a hat for sun protection during the day. This is a very pleasant time to be outdoors, with comfortable evenings for live concerts.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summer brings high heat and humidity that can feel quite intense in the afternoon. Stay hydrated and wear breathable fabrics to stay cool. The humidity can linger into the evening, so prepare for warm conditions while standing in the outdoor courtyard for the show.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ers some of the best weather of the year with lower humidity and very pleasant temperatures. It is a perfect time for outdoor concerts as the evenings become crisp and cool. A light layer is often enough to stay comfortable throughout the night.

📅

Rain & snow

Snow is virtually non-existent in this part of Florida. However, brief and heavy afternoon rain showers are common, especially in the summer. Always carry a small, portable poncho to keep dry if a sudden storm passes through the downtown area during your visit.
